How The Pepin Mansion Ballroom Is Used for Louisville Wedding Receptions

perfect wedding venue

The ballroom at The Pepin Mansion is used for seated dinners, buffet receptions, cocktail parties, and everything in between. Couples often ask how the space handles different reception styles, guest counts, and timelines. Here's what actually happens in the ballroom during a wedding reception.

The Pepin Mansion ballroom is used for wedding receptions by accommodating seated dinners, buffet service, or cocktail-style events for up to 120 guests indoors. It supports flexible layouts, dance floors, and bar setups, while coordination, including furnishings, and vendor flexibility help ensure a smooth transition from dining to dancing or even from ceremony to reception.

 

The Space and How It's Set Up

 

The ballroom sits inside our historic building with painted ceilings, crown moldings, and original woodwork. It's climate-controlled, so your reception runs comfortably whether it's Kentucky Derby season in May or a January evening. We seat up to 120 guests indoors for a plated dinner with room for the dance floor and bar setup. If you're hosting a standing cocktail reception or a buffet with mixed seating, the number shifts higher.

 

Set up and cleanup are included in our wedding packages, and our event planner coordinates with your caterer on table placement, bar location, and the flow from dinner to dancing. Package inclusions vary, but our all inclusive wedding options include gold Chiavari chairs plus table settings like linens, china, glassware, and flatware. Your event planner will confirm exactly what is included with the package you choose.

Reception Styles That Work in the Ballroom

 

The ballroom handles both formal seated dinners and more casual receptions. For a plated dinner, we set long banquet tables or round tables, depending on your preference and guest count. Your caterer serves each course, and we coordinate timing so the meal, toasts, and cake cutting happen without lag. For buffet service, we work with your caterer to plan a layout that keeps lines moving and leaves space for seating and dancing.

If you're planning a cocktail-style reception with passed appetizers and small bites, we can arrange tables and lounge seating clusters. This setup works well for receptions where guests move around and mingle rather than sitting for a full meal. Some couples use the ballroom for the reception only and hold their ceremony outdoors on the enhanced ceremony deck or under the tented event lawn, then flip the space for dinner and dancing.

Music, Dancing, and Bar Service

 

We offer music options that include live performers or a DJ. The ballroom has string lights and permanent lighting, and the acoustics work well with both live bands and sound systems. Dance floor placement depends on your table plan and reception style.

 

For bar service, you can work with a licensed caterer to provide a full bar, or you can use our BYO bar service option and bring your own alcohol, which saves fifty to sixty percent. We also set up cash bars, open bars, or consumption-based bars, depending on what you prefer. The bar usually sits near the entrance or along the back wall, keeping it accessible without blocking the dance floor or table service.

Moving from Ceremony to Reception in the Same Space

 

If you're using the ballroom for both your ceremony and reception, we handle the flip while you're taking photos or hosting a cocktail hour. Guests witness the ceremony with chairs arranged theater style, then move to our Formal Parlor or outdoors for cocktails. During that window, we reset the ballroom with your reception tables, linens, place settings, and decor.

 

This approach works if you want everything in one climate-controlled location and you don't want to move your guests between buildings or outdoor and indoor spaces. The painted ceilings and crown moldings give you a ceremony backdrop without needing extra decor, and the same architectural details carry through to your reception.

Catering Flexibility and Vendor Coordination

 

We have an open vendor policy, so you choose your caterer. Outside catering is allowed, and we have a catering prep kitchen that your team can use for plating, heating, and staging. Our event planner coordinates with your caterer on load-in times, table timing, and service flow so everything runs on schedule.

 

Whether you're serving a three-course plated dinner, a family-style meal, or a buffet with stations, the ballroom accommodates the setup. Your caterer has access to our kitchen, and we provide the tables, chairs, and table settings. You handle the menu and service style, and we make sure the logistics work.
